Title :
People, time and money: organizing your resources for a successful publishing project

Abstract :
Regardless of whether you are producing a traditional print document, developing online help systems, or designing a home page for the Internet, you still must organize a project team, develop a schedule, and establish a budget. This workshop identifies characteristics of successful projects, involves participants in identifying real world trouble-spots that can sabotage success, and presents some industry “best practices”. This workshop is appropriate for anyone responsible for producing documentation-whether you do it alone, manage an in-house staff, or coordinate outside resources
